Labrador spreads campaign money to GOP state legislative hopefuls
During a two-day stretch in late October, Idaho GOP Congressman Raul Labrador sent campaign contributions of either $250 or $500 to 40 GOP candidates for the Idaho Legislature, plus $10,000 to the Idaho Republican Party.

Statesman picks Demo over Labrador
The Idaho Statesman has endorsed Democrat James Piotrowski over Republican Congressman Raul Labrador, stating it’s time for a change: “we want more from our representative than the frequent “No” votes … especially on spending bills where there are few other responsible choices than for Congress to vote to fund our government.”
Federal judge rejects challenge to Idaho’s ‘right to work’ law over fees, appeal likely
A federal judge in Idaho has ruled against a challenge to the state’s Right to Work law, but the case now likely will be appealed to the 9th Circuit U.S. Court of Appeals.

Judge OKs preliminary settlement in Idaho Medicaid lawsuit
A federal judge has approved a preliminary settlement between developmentally disabled Idaho residents and the state Department of Health and Welfare, the ACLU-Idaho announced Monday. The settlement requires the state to develop a new tool for determining some Medicaid benefits, to give participants more information about budget changes…

Eye on Boise: Labrador slams Democratic challenger Piotrowski over ‘socialist’ tweet
During a televised debate, 1st District GOP Rep. Raul Labrador went after his Democratic challenger, James Piotrowski, saying, “He’s not a moderate,” and reading a tweet that Piotrowski sent from his personal Twitter account in February of this year. The tweet: “@BernieSanders this tweet cost you the vote of this lifelong progressive, labor activist and socialist. This was beneath you.” The tweet was posted at 7 p.m. on Feb. 3, 2016. It’s since been deleted.
